10 Popular Girl Names That Start With T
These girl names with T consistently rank high in popularity thanks to their charm, versatility, and modern appeal. Whether you’re looking for something strong, sweet, or stylish, these trending choices have stood the test of time with parents everywhere.
1. Talia — This name means “gentle dew from Heaven” in Hebrew.
2. Tara — An Irish name meaning “rocky hill.”
3. Tatiana — Russian for “fairy queen.”
4. Tatum — English for “Tate’s Homestead.” “Tate” is derived from the village of Tatham.
5. Taylor — This is an English occupational name for a tailor.
6. Teagan — Irish for “little poet” and Welsh for “fair.”
7. Tessa — This name means “to gather” in English.
8. Thea — Greek for “goddess” or “godly.”
9. Tilly — A German name meaning “battle mighty.”
10. Trinity — In Latin, this name means “triad.”

8 Bible Names for a Girl That Start With T
Each of these T names for girls can be found in the Bible. If you’re interested in finding the perfect biblical name for your daughter, you’ve come to the right place.
1. Talitha — Aramaic for “little girl.”
2. Tamar — This name means “date palm tree” in Hebrew.
3. Tamari — Georgian for “date palm tree.”
4. Terah — A Hebrew name meaning “wind” or “wanderer.”
5. Tirzah — Hebrew for “delight.”
6. Tryphena — In Greek, this name means “softness” or “delicacy.”
7. Tryphosa — This name also means “softness” or “delicacy” in Greek.
8. Tzipporah — Hebrew for “bird.”
